Full Description
This exam emphasizes the principles of renal replacement therapy including hemodialysis, peritoneal dialysis, and kidney transplantation. Candidates will discuss the indications for each modality.
Knowledge of renal replacement therapy is essential in nephrology, given the growing prevalence of end-stage renal disease and the necessity for effective patient management strategies.
The candidate's verbal assessment will focus on the ability to describe the mechanisms, indications, and potential outcomes associated with each mode of replacement therapy.
Candidates will also discuss the multidisciplinary approach required to manage patients undergoing renal replacement therapy.
Sample Questions
- What are the primary indications for initiating dialysis?
- Explain the differences between hemodialysis and peritoneal dialysis.
